    Sampling a 2022 vintage of this beer poured at cellar temp into my snifter. Part of the Big Stouts box from BA.
    The beer is in a 12 oz stubby bottle and pours a rich cola brown into my glass. A creamy dense beige to tan head of 1 cm foams up and fades to a sturdy edge layer and some wispy surface covering soon after the pour.
    Aroma on this is robust! I get dark chocolate, tobacco, charred wood, roasted malt, molasses and some whiskey. Nose is also black peppery spicy heat. No hint of any hop character.
    First sip reveals a fairly thick body and sticky texture with fine tingly carbonation. Beer does leave a bit of residue on my lips with each sip.
    Flavor is similar to the nose advertisements. I get dark chocolate, roasted notes and some tobacco hits. Moves to a whisky note that lingers long after each swallow. No hint of any hops and I do get a bit of spicy booze with accompanying warmth after each swallow. The warmth isnt really heat nor does it slow down my consumption of this 15% brew. I suspect this will definitely catch up with me by the end of the sampling. Glad to have tried this one as I do enjoy it quite a bit as a straight forward big boozy barrel aged imperial stout.
    Well worth picking up a bottle. No surprises here.

    This version is 13.1% ABV. It's kind of thin overall, in flavor and body, with little barrel presence. Up front I get a moderately strong mocha flavor that is quite nice. The finish is an ashy, bitter coffee note that, while it's not entirely unpleasant, doesn't leave me craving more. There is a little whiskey throughout and maybe oak at the end. I should add that the coffee in the aroma is more balanced and well incorporated than in the flavor.
